Description:
Explore the future of China's Belt and Road Initiative (BRI) in this hour-long panel discussion from the World Economic Forum. Gain insights from international experts, including representatives from the United Nations, Bangladesh government, and Chinese industry leaders, as they analyze the BRI's impact on global cooperation, economic development, and geopolitical dynamics. Delve into topics such as Bangladesh's role in the initiative, foreign investment opportunities, environmental concerns, and the potential for a new Cold War. Learn about the current stage of development, the importance of quality investments, and the role of private companies in the BRI. Understand the Eurasian vision and the concept of third-party development as panelists discuss the initiative's future trajectory and its implications for China and the world.
